Industry Group Issues Report Touting Fracking Boom Benefits to Economy

person holding a tablet with the national trial lawyers news webpage on the screen

News Inferno; September 5, 2013

An industry-funded report states that the uptick in hydraulic fracturing (fracking) activities has benefited the economy with jobs, revenue, and household income increases.

While some believe fracking is an answer to a downturned economy and energy independence, more believe the drilling is putting the fresh water supplies for millions of people at risk. The risk is greater for those living closest to the drilling boom.

The report, issued by industry group, HIS CERA, cited booming natural gas and oil production, which has supported 2.1 million jobs, added nearly $75 billion in federal revenue, and increased household income by $1,200, according to Bloomberg.com.
